Você está na página 1de 2

24/1/2014

Comandos para usar o mdulo de pen drive com o Arduino

pesquisar...

MENU PRINCIPAL
Principal Artigos de usurios Ambiente de Aprendizagem Tutoriais
Arduino Banco de Dados Celulares e Tablets Diversos Internet Mac Raspberry Pi Linguagem de Programao Linux Window s

Comandos para usar o mdulo de pen drive com o Arduino


Ter, 03 de Julho de 2012 01:01 Bryan Frizzarin Fernando

TRANSLATION
Selecione o idioma
Pow ered by

Tradutor

Avaliao do Usurio: Pior


Tw eetar 18

/4 Melhor A VA LIA R
Recom endar

Escrevi outros dois tutoriais praticamente sobre esse mesmo assunto, sendo um especificamente para leitura de dados do pen drive (http://www.seucurso.com.br/index.php? option=com_content&view=article&id=139:lendo-dados-de-um-pen-drive-usando-oarduino&catid=901:arduino&Itemid=65) e outro apenas para gravar dados no pen drive (http://www.seucurso.com.br/index.php?option=com_content&view=article&id=146:gravando-dadosem-pen-drive-usando-o-arduino&catid=901:arduino&Itemid=65), mas a verdade que para comunicar-se com o mdulo USB existem outros muitos comandos. Com a mesma montagem de hardware dos artigos anteriores e com o programa abaixo, voc pode, usando o Monitor Serial do ambiente de desenvolvimento do Arduino, enviar comandos para o mdulo USB e o pen drive e ver a resposta:
0 1 . 0 2 . 0 3 . 0 4 . 0 5 . 0 6 . 0 7 . 0 8 . 0 9 . 1 0 . 1 1 . 1 2 . 1 3 . 1 4 . 1 5 . 1 6 . 1 7 . 1 8 . 1 9 . 2 0 . 2 1 . 2 2 . 2 3 . 2 4 . 2 5 . 2 6 . 2 7 . 2 8 . 2 9 . 3 0 . 3 1 . 3 2 . 3 3 . # i n c l u d e < S o f t w a r e S e r i a l . h > S o f t w a r e S e r i a lp e n d r i v e ( 2 , 3 ) ; v o i ds e t u p ( ){ S e r i a l . b e g i n ( 9 6 0 0 ) ; p e n d r i v e . b e g i n ( 9 6 0 0 ) ; } v o i dl o o p ( ){ c h a re n t r a d a=0 ; S t r i n gr e s p o s t a=" " ; w h i l e ( p e n d r i v e . a v a i l a b l e ( ) ){ e n t r a d a=p e n d r i v e . r e a d ( ) ; i f ( e n t r a d a>0 ) r e s p o s t a+ =e n t r a d a ; } p e n d r i v e . f l u s h ( ) ; i f ( ! r e s p o s t a . e q u a l s ( " " ) )S e r i a l . p r i n t l n ( r e s p o s t a ) ; d e l a y ( 1 0 0 ) ; S t r i n gc o m a n d o=" " ; w h i l e ( S e r i a l . a v a i l a b l e ( ) ){ e n t r a d a=S e r i a l . r e a d ( ) ; i f ( e n t r a d a>0 ) c o m a n d o+ =e n t r a d a ; } S e r i a l . f l u s h ( ) ; i f ( ! c o m a n d o . e q u a l s ( " " ) ){ S e r i a l . p r i n t l n ( " C o m a n d o>"+c o m a n d o ) ; p e n d r i v e . p r i n t ( c o m a n d o ) ; p e n d r i v e . w r i t e ( 1 3 ) ; d e l a y ( 1 0 0 ) ; } }

Frum Links Contato Webmail

ENTRAR
Nome de Usurio

Senha

Remember Me
LOGIN

Forgot your password? Forgot your username? Create an account

Os comandos que podem ser passados so:

Comando
e[CR] E[CR] SCS[CR] ESC[CR] IPA[CR] IPH[CR] FWV[CR]

Resposta
Retorna a l etra e como eco, pa ra veri fi ca o de bom funci ona mento. Retorna a l etra E como eco, pa ra veri fi ca o de bom funci ona mento. Al tera pa ra o conjunto de coma ndos curtos Al tera pa ra o conjunto de coma ndos l ongos Confi gura o mdul o pa ra tra ba l ha r com va l ores ASCII Confi gura o mdul o pa ra tra ba l ha r com va l ores hexa deci ma i s . Exi be a s i nforma es de fi rmwa re.

http://www.seucurso.com.br/index.php?option=com_content&view=article&id=147:comandos-para-usar-o-modulo-de-pen-drive-com-o-arduino&catid=901:ar

1/2

24/1/2014

Comandos para usar o mdulo de pen drive com o Arduino


DIR[CR] DIR nome_do_a rqui vo[CR] MKD nome_do_di retori o[CR] CD nome_do_di retori o[CR] CD ..[CR] DLD nome_do_di retori o[CR] OPW nome_do_a rqui vo[CR] CLF nome_do_a rqui vo[CR] WRF byte_a _s erem_gra va dos [CR]da dos [CR] RD nome_do_a rqui vo[CR] OPR nome_do_a rqui vo RDF bytes _a _s erem_l i dos [CR] IDD[CR] IDDE[CR] DSN[CR] DVL[CR] SUD[CR] WKD[CR] Mos tra os a rqui vos no di retri o a tua l . Mos tra nome e ta ma nho do a rqui vo Cri a o di retri o Entre no di retri o Sa i do di retri o a tua l Apa ga o di retri o Abre o a rqui vo pa ra gra va o. Fecha o a rqui vo que deve ter s i do a berto a nteri ormente pa ra l ei tura ou gra va o. Gra va a qua nti da de de no a rqui vo a berto a tua l mente pa ra gra va o. L todo o contedo do a rqui vo . Abre o a rqui vo pa ra l ei tura . L bytes do a rqui vo a berto .a tua l mente pa ra l ei tura . Exi be a s i nforma es de pen dri ve menores que 4Gi B. Exi be a s i nforma es de pen dri ve ma i ores que 4Gi B. Exi be o nmero s eri a l do pen dri ve. Exi be o nome do pen dri ve. Col oca o mdul o em es ta do de dormnci a . Acorda o mdul o.

Obs.: [CR] o caractere ASCII decimal 13 ou hexadecimal 0D equivalente ao ENTER.

MOSTRAR OUTROS ARTIGOS DESTE AUTOR


ADICIONAR COMENTRIO Nome (obrigatrio) E-mail (obrigatrio) Ttulo (obrigatrio)

Voc ainda pode digitar 1000 caracte re s

Notifique-me de comentrios futuros

Atualizar

Enviar
J C omments

http://www.seucurso.com.br/index.php?option=com_content&view=article&id=147:comandos-para-usar-o-modulo-de-pen-drive-com-o-arduino&catid=901:ar

2/2

Você também pode gostar